Chrome扩展程序:在标记之间读取文本

时间:2014-09-02 17:51:08

标签: javascript google-chrome-extension

我是制作Chrome扩展程序的新手。我试图在类标记之间读取文本,例如:

<div id="AssetThumbnail" class="thumbnail-holder"  data-3d-thumbs-enabled data-url="/thumbnail/asset?assetId=111795617&amp;thumbnailFormatId=6912&amp;width=320&amp;height=320" style="width:320px; height:320px;">
    <span class="thumbnail-span" **data-3d-url=**"/asset-thumbnail-3d/json?assetId=111795617"  data-js-files='http://js.rbxcdn.com/a552a24cb2c7a47ad748fd129a2e9624.js.gzip' ><img  class='' src='http://t7.rbxcdn.com/7cfa58047697662d12f33d68b71e5f42' /></span>
    <span class="enable-three-dee btn-control btn-control-small"></span>
</div>

我想从 data-3d-url = 获取文字。我在代码中用星号包围它,这样你就可以看到我所指的是什么。

1 个答案:

答案 0 :(得分:0)

使用jQuery,您可以使用以下代码段检索类似的属性。

alert($('.thumbnail-span').attr("data-3d-url"));

然后,您可以更改警报功能以设置变量或您想要使用该值的其他任何内容。

这是一个JSFiddle示例:http://jsfiddle.net/r1umr3s5/1/